
A growing number of miners are turning to swimming pools to cool their equipment, sparking curiosity and discussion in online forums. Recent feedback shows that people are actively engaging with this unconventional method, sharing setups and insights on how to effectively integrate mining rigs with pool systems.
Utilizing swimming pools for cooling is gaining traction as enthusiasts look for efficient solutions to overheating problems. "Going to heat the swimming pool with the L7?" questioned one participant, highlighting the skepticism and intrigue surrounding this approach.
Heat Utilization: A user noted the potential benefits of using hot water for home heating, stating, "Why waste the heat? One guy I know uses it for his hot water in the house."
Chemical Considerations: Concerns about pool chemicals have surfaced, particularly regarding copper and aluminum corrosion. One miner advised, "Your system needs to be stainless steel; chlorine and salt both destroy copper or aluminum."
Community Insights: "Are people seriously running lines out to actually swimming pools?" expressed another person, showing the amazed reactions to this practice.
As the crypto landscape shifts, adapting cooling techniques has become crucial. By incorporating swimming pools, miners can potentially lower cooling costs and improve efficiency. This movement resonates positively, as many view it as innovative and practical.
"Minimum chlorine, I know it eats the copper and aluminum of the heat exchanger, but Iβll replace that every year," shared an engaged person, illustrating the willingness to experiment despite drawbacks.
